Manganese shares the uniport mechanism of mitochondrial calcium influx, accumulates in mitochondria and is cleared only very slowly from brain. Using dual-label isotope techniques, we have investigated both Mn2" and Ca2" mitochondrial efflux kinetics. It is well-established that subcompartments of endoplasmic reticulum (ER) are in physical contact with the mitochondria. These lipid raft-like regions of ER are referred to as mitochondria-associated ER membranes (MAMs), and they play an important role in, for example, lipid synthesis, calcium homeostasis, and apoptotic signaling. Brain mitochondria are relatively resistant to calcium-induced mitochondrial permeability transition (MPT), with heterogenic response to the insult. The cause for this heterogeneity is not clear, so we studied the distribution of a key regulator of the MPT, cyclophilin D (cypD), within the rat brain by using immunohistology and Western blotting. Tricyclodecan-9-yl-xanthogenate (D609) has in vivo and in vitro antioxidant properties. D609 mimics glutathione (GSH) and has a free thiol group, which upon oxidation forms a disulfide. The resulting dixanthate is a substrate for glutathione reductase, regenerating D609.
